Abstract
Extraction radiochemical investigations of ternary ion-association thiocyanate complexes of Co(II) with nitroblue tetrazolium chloride (NBT) [(3,3-dianizol-4,4-bis) 2-(4-nitrophenyl)-5-phenylnitrotetrazolium chloride] and triphenyltetrazolium chloride (TTC) [2,3,5-triphenyltetrazolium chloride] have been carried out. Molar ratios of the reacting components have been determined as NBT/[Co (SCN)4]2−=1∶1 and TTC/[Co(SCN)4]2−=2∶1. Using a chemical model and the method of Likussar — Boltz we have determined the values β, Kex and KD, characterizing the extraction process. The results have been statistically treated. The relative standard deviation Sr has been calculated at a confidence level of 95%.
